Compare Alpha Capital Markets vs selftrade Commission And Fees
Alpha Capital Markets and selftrade are online broker platforms, and many online brokerages charge lower prices than traditional brokerages tend to charge. The cause of this is that the businesses of online brokerages are scaled much better. In other words, an online broker isn't necessarily affected by the number of customers they have.
However, this doesn't necessarily mean that online brokers do not charge any fees. They charge fees of varying rates for a variety of services to make money. There are mainly three types of fees for this objective.
The first sort of charges to look out for are trading charges. Whenever you make an actual trade, like buying a stock or an ETF, you're charged trading charges. In these cases, you're paying a spread, funding speed, or even a commission. The sorts of trading fees and the rates differ from broker to broker.
Commissions can be fixed or dependent on the traded volume. On the flip side, a spread refers to the gap between the buying and selling cost. Financing or overnight prices are people who are billed when you hold a leveraged position for more than a day.
Aside from trading fees, online agents also charge non-trading fees. These are determined by the actions you undertake on your accounts. They're billed for operations like depositing cash, not trading for long periods, or withdrawals.
